100GbE Intel Wired LAN Driver Updates 2020-07-23

This series contains updates to ice driver only.

Jake refactors ice_discover_caps() to reduce the number of AdminQ calls
made. Splits ice_parse_caps() to separate functions to update function
and device capabilities separately to allow for updating outside of
initialization.

Akeem adds power management support.

Paul G refactors FC and FEC code to aid in restoring of PHY settings
on media insertion. Implements lenient mode and link override support.
Adds link debug info and formats existing debug info to be more
readable. Adds support to check and report additional autoneg
capabilities. Implements the capability to detect media cage in order to
differentiate AUI types as Direct Attach or backplane.

Bruce implements Total Port Shutdown for devices that support it.

Lev renames low_power_ctrl field to lower_power_ctrl_an to be more
descriptive of the field.

Doug reports AOC types as media type fiber.

Paul S adds code to handle 1G SGMII PHY type.
